When it comes to managing respiratory conditions such as asthma, using an inhaler is a common form of treatment. Inhalers deliver medication directly to the lungs, providing quick relief from symptoms such as wheezing, shortness of breath, and chest tightness. However, simply owning an inhaler is not enough – proper storage and maintenance are crucial for the effectiveness of the medication. This is where an inhaler and chamber case comes into play.

An inhaler and chamber case is a convenient and practical way to store your inhaler and spacer chamber. The spacer chamber is often used with inhalers to ensure that the medication is properly delivered to the lungs. By keeping these devices together in one case, you can easily access them when needed and protect them from damage.
